The 12 feet by 8 feet pure silk flag was hoisted after lowering the British Union Jack on August 15, 1947 at 5.05am at Fort St George. The only surviving vintage national flag in India, hoisted at Fort St George in Chennai on the first Independence Day on August 15, 1947, is being conserved by the Archaeological Survey of India #nadodian#India#Flag#British#Nostalgia#Archaeologicalsurveyofindia#Chennai#NationalFlag#Madras#Freedom#TriColor#SingaraChennai#Heritage#Tamilnadu#IndependenceDay#History#Madrasapattinam #MadrasDay#Madeinmadras#Museum (at Fort St. George, India)
